Stanly County NC low traffic road cycling routes offer a diverse landscape for cyclists. The region is characterized by rolling hills, which provide varied terrain from gentle gradients to more challenging climbs. It is situated in the lower Piedmont region and features the Uwharrie Mountains, including Morrow Mountain. Numerous lakes and rivers, such as Lake Tillery and Badin Lake, contribute to scenic routes with picturesque shorelines.

Morrow Mountain is one of the highest mountains in the region. You can ride to the summit via Marrow Mountain Road taking in the awesome views of the green forest and the Pee Dee River in the distance on your way up. At the summit you will find some hiking trails and a picnic area.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see along these routes?

Stanly County's no-traffic routes offer diverse natural beauty. You'll cycle through areas characterized by rolling hills, often with views of the ancient Uwharrie Mountains. Many routes also feature picturesque shorelines along lakes such as Lake Tillery, Badin Lake, and Falls Reservoir, as well as the Rocky River and Pee Dee River. Morrow Mountain State Park, a 'crown jewel' of the region, is also a prominent feature in the area.

Are there any notable landmarks or points of interest along the no-traffic cycling routes?

While specific routes focus on natural beauty, the broader Stanly County area offers several points of interest that can complement your cycling trip. You might pass by areas near Morrow Mountain State Park, which offers hiking and a Natural History Museum. The region is also home to several vineyards, including Dennis Vineyards Winery and Morgan Ridge Vineyard, and the historic Reed Gold Mine is another notable attraction. What is the typical length and elevation gain for these routes?

The no-traffic road cycling routes in Stanly County vary significantly in length and elevation. Distances range from approximately 38 kilometers (24 miles) for easier rides, such as the Roadbike loop from Polk Mountain, up to over 100 kilometers (62 miles) for more challenging options like the Badin Lake loop from Red Cross. Elevation gains can range from around 200 meters (650 feet) to nearly 1000 meters (3,280 feet), offering options for all fitness levels.
